Streaming Platforms
Paramount+
Paramount+ is the go-to destination for Survivor enthusiasts. Here’s why:
- Extensive Library: Paramount+ boasts nearly every season of Survivor, from the early days on the beaches of Borneo to the latest adventures in Fiji.
- Live Streaming: Catch new episodes live as they air on CBS.
- On-Demand Access: Watch episodes anytime, anywhere.
- Exclusive Content: Enjoy behind-the-scenes footage, interviews, and exclusive clips.
Hulu
Hulu offers another excellent avenue for watching Survivor. Here’s what you need to know:
- Current Seasons: Hulu typically streams current seasons of Survivor shortly after they air on CBS.
- On-Demand Viewing: Watch episodes at your convenience.
- Hulu + Live TV: With Hulu + Live TV, you can stream Survivor live and record episodes for later viewing.
Amazon Prime Video
While Amazon Prime Video doesn’t always have every season available for streaming with a standard Prime membership, you can often purchase individual episodes or seasons.
- Purchase Options: Buy episodes or entire seasons to add to your digital library.
- Add-on Channels: Subscribe to Paramount+ through Amazon Prime Video to access the same content available on the standalone Paramount+ app.
Traditional TV
CBS
For those who prefer traditional television, CBS remains the primary broadcaster for new episodes of Survivor.
- Live Broadcasts: Watch new episodes live on CBS every Wednesday (check local listings for times).
- CBS Website/App: Stream episodes live or on-demand through the CBS website or app with a cable provider login.
Other Options
YouTube TV
YouTube TV offers a comprehensive streaming package that includes CBS, allowing you to watch Survivor live and record episodes for later viewing.
FuboTV
Similar to YouTube TV, FuboTV also includes CBS in its channel lineup, providing another option for live streaming Survivor.
